What Happens If ADHD is Left Untreated in Adults?

Untreated ADHD can lead to a range of issues for adults. These problems can affect relationships, work and mental health.

Adults suffering from untreated ADHD often suffer from low self-esteem, as well as have a negative outlook on the world. This can make them feel like they're failing in their work and at home.

Lack of Focus

Finding it difficult to stay focused from time to time is normal, especially after a long day at school or at work. If you find that your ability to focus is deteriorating, and is affecting your life, then it might be time to seek help. If you are finding it difficult to complete your daily chores, do not attend important social events, or make mistakes in the workplace that can impact your reputation, this could be an indication of a bigger issue.

Relationship problems

Relationship issues can be caused by ADHD symptoms like confusion, impulsivity, and forgetfulness. It's not uncommon for people who are not ADHD to be frustrated, resentful, and even left out by their ADHD partner. This can lead to a tense mess of emotions that leads to a breakdown in the relationship and ultimately the breakup.

ADHD can also cause problems in relationships with family members and friends. It can cause financial stress when a person fails to pay their bills or manage their finances effectively. It can also cause emotional stress if one reacts in a different way and experiences rapid mood swings.

One of the most common issues that occur when someone with ADHD is untreated is that their partner or spouse starts to overhelp them. This is problematic because it hinders someone with ADHD from gaining independence. This can lead to the person with ADHD becoming resentful of their partner or spouse because they are always taking care of them.

If a person suffering from ADHD in a relationship does not receive treatment, they may interpret the behavior of their partner and assume that they have ulterior motives. When a partner with ADHD doesn't attend a meeting scheduled, it could be interpreted as a sign they do not respect you or your relationship.

In addition, when a person who suffers from ADHD is not properly treated they could experience cognitive problems that can affect their ability to understand and respond to other people's requirements. For instance, they may struggle to comprehend complex concepts and may skip over important details when listening. They may also have issues with conversational self-restraint that can manifest as interfering with others or talking over them.

You and your partner are able to resolve these issues by speaking clearly and regularly. It's a good idea for everyone to take part in regular family gatherings to discuss issues and come up with ways to work together to resolve these issues. If this doesn't work, you may be interested in couples counseling to gain new communication techniques and organizational strategies you can use outside the therapist's office.

Health Issues

Adults suffering from ADHD have a hard time controlling their emotions and impulses, which can cause problems in their personal and professional lives. Their impulsivity can cause them to take actions that could harm themselves and others, or result in risky behaviors such as reckless driving, which can lead to injury or even death. They also can struggle to handle their daily tasks, including staying organized, meeting deadlines or completing work tasks.

ADHD symptoms in adults differ than those seen in children. This could lead to misdiagnosis or missed treatment options. Adults can experience symptoms such as difficulties in paying attention at classes, poor writing skills and a tendency to forget professional or social plans. They may not be able to prioritize their work or complete long-term projects which can impact their career and financial stability. They may have difficulty interpreting social cues in the context of their lives and are likely to interrupt other people frequently or interfere in their conversations, which can cause tension and make it difficult to establish meaningful relationships.

Additionally, they may struggle to maintain healthy lifestyles and fail to attend regular health screenings, which could exacerbate physical health conditions like heart disease, hypertension or obesity. They might have trouble getting enough sleep because their minds are racing with thoughts that are distracting at night, or they may consume unhealthy foods that contribute to weight growth and poor health.

Untreated ADHD can also result in depression or other mood disorders that could affect a person's quality of life. It can cause people to lose confidence and self-esteem, and they may have difficulty to keep jobs or relationships as their behavior worsens as time passes. Undiagnosed ADHD can lead adults to live the existence of boredom and depression. They may even develop suicidal thoughts.

Fortunately, ADHD is highly treatable with medication. There are a variety of medications available and healthcare professionals will consider each individual's symptoms when determining the right treatment plan. Certain adults may need to test a variety of dosages and medications before settling on the one that is right for them, but the majority of people report being much more successful at work, school and home once their symptoms are treated with medications.

Many people with untreated ADHD are also afflicted by depression. The symptoms of both disorders overlap, and they frequently occur in conjunction. Depression is more serious than a severe blues episode. It can lead to a lack in motivation to do the things you enjoy, and even lead to thoughts of suicide.

Individual therapy can help those suffering from ADHD manage depression. Depression can be caused by a myriad of causes, including the trauma of childhood or abuse, financial problems or stress in relationships, as well as the emotional consequences of long-standing patterns of underachievement in the workplace and at school. ADHD can be a factor in these types of issues and can exacerbate them since people who have not been treated for ADHD are more likely to suffer from low self-esteem and a sense of being unworthy in different areas of their lives.

Treatment options may include medication and psychotherapy, which is typically referred to as cognitive behavioral therapy. Cognitive behavioral therapy helps individuals learn to alter their negative behavior and develop healthy coping strategies. Counselors can help people learn stress-reduction strategies, including regular physical exercise, ensuring adequate sleep and eating healthy.

The good news is that most people who suffer from ADHD do not experience depression severe. However, the longer ADHD goes undiagnosed and untreated the more it will interfere with a person's quality of life as they get older and their responsibilities grow more complicated. ADHD is characterised by impulsivity and insufficient concentration, which can make it difficult for adults to keep track of their obligations to their families, work and personal finances. This means that they could end in debt, have a hard finding work and are frustrated when they aren't successful at work or home.

There are effective treatments for both ADHD and Depression. The use of medication can reduce the symptoms of ADHD and is often paired with nonstimulant medication which can be used to treat depression. Some people suffering from ADHD can manage their depression using antidepressants. However, it's essential that an experienced health professional assess the person's mood and medical history prior to prescribing any medication.
